sixty-seven million, nine hundred ninety-nine thousand, four hundred fifty-eight
Currency CA$67999458 in canadian english: sixty-seven million, nine hundred ninety-nine thousand, four hundred fifty-eight Canadian dollar.
In Price: 67999458.00
66999458 | 68999458